Positive Temperature Coefficient (PTC) resettable fuses are innovative components in the electronics industry that automatically reset after a fault condition is cleared. These fuses exhibit a resistance that increases with temperature, causing a self-limiting effect during overcurrent situations. PTC resettable fuses are widely used in applications where protection against overcurrent events is essential, such as in power supplies, batteries, and automotive electronics. Their ability to reset and restore functionality makes them a convenient and reliable choice for continuous protection.
